Overall how is your satisfaction of the Vedolux?
Any issues with the controls?
Have you protected the power coming in to the boiler? I ask as i have very dirty power where i live.
I have been watching your journey with the new boiler as i will have to replace mine at some point.

No control issues . Have gone threw one nozzle. Our power is clean and in a power failure run with a Honda EU generator. Very happy with the boiler and it only takes 15 minutes to fully clean and clean about every 12 fires.
